No, there is no direct train from Wrexham to Heathrow Terminal 4. However, there are services departing from Wrexham General and arriving at Heathrow Terminal 4 via Chester, Euston station and Tottenham Court Road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 15m.
The distance between Wrexham and Heathrow Terminal 4 is 211 miles. The road distance is 178.6 miles.
